Realbotix (TSX-V: XBOT, OTC: XBOTF) has announced a collaboration with Tix4, established on April 8, 2025, to develop an interactive robotic customer service agent. The pilot program will launch at Tix4's kiosk in Fashion Show Las Vegas, where the company has historically sold over 15 million tickets.
The robotic agent will be programmed to answer questions, provide show recommendations, and assist customers with ticket purchases. The initiative aims to enhance customer service efficiency while delivering an engaging in-person experience. Tix4's robotic agent will feature custom-designed interactions specific to Las Vegas entertainment, utilizing Realbotix's AI software for natural conversations about shows, venues, and ticket options.
The beta testing phase is scheduled to commence in summer 2025, demonstrating Realbotix's capability to customize robots for various retail and hospitality applications.

Realbotix (TSX-V: XBOT, OTC: XBOTF) and Hollo.AI have successfully demonstrated their collaborative AI-powered robot at the 37th Annual Roth Capital Partners Conference in Dana Point, California. The integration combines Realbotix's open source robotics and lip sync technology with Hollo.AI's character-based AI digital twin and personality engine.
The demonstration featured the robot assuming the personality of Chrissy Snow from the TV sitcom Three's Company, developed in collaboration with Alan Hamel, CEO of SuzanneSomers.com. Unlike other robotics companies to single LLM integration, Realbotix robots can incorporate various personalities through third-party LLM integrations.
This first-of-its-kind collaboration enables the creation of physical avatars representing living or deceased individuals for entertainment, educational, or marketing purposes, marking a significant milestone in merging AI software with humanoid robotics.
Realbotix (TSX-V: XBOT, OTC: XBOTF) has launched its proprietary Realbotix Robotic AI Vision System, featuring advanced capabilities including user face recognition, object recognition, face tracking, and real-time scene detection. The system integrates with cloud-based multimodal AI and large language models to enable more contextual interactions.
Key features include human recognition with dynamic facial expressions, personalized user experiences through facial data upload, real-time object detection, and scene analysis. The system is complemented by Realbotix's patented realistic eyeball technology, which offers modular eye color options.
The technology has applications across healthcare, retail, security, smart homes, and social robotics sectors. The beta version was showcased at CES 2025 in Las Vegas. The system will be available with new robot purchases for fall delivery, with retrofit options for existing models.

Realbotix (XBOTF) reported strong Q1-2025 financial results, with total revenue increasing 419% to $858k compared to Q1-2024. The company achieved a net income of $918,324 and increased its total digital assets and cash by 8% to $10.6 million.
Key developments include the TSXV's approval of a Normal Course Issuer Bid allowing the purchase of up to 9,797,779 Common Shares, a partnership with Compass UOL including a $100,000 AWS subsidy, and the launch of a new customer-focused website. The company unveiled its latest humanoid robot, Melody, at CES 2025, generating over 4 billion media impressions.
Realbotix also received approximately $1.01M from Genesis, representing 40% of their SOL claim, and 222.2 ETH (77% of ETH claim). The company announced integration capabilities with major LLMs including ChatGPT, Llama, Gemini, and DeepSeek R1.

Realbotix (TSX-V: XBOT, OTC: XBOTF) announced the expansion of its humanoid robot capabilities through integration with major third-party AI platforms, launching in February 2025. The update will enable connection to platforms like ChatGPT, Llama, Gemini, and DeepSeek R1.
The integration supports both local and cloud-based AI providers, offering conversational abilities in multiple languages including Spanish, Cantonese, Mandarin, French, and English. The company's proprietary lip sync technology will ensure precise mouth movements during speech.
The rollout schedule includes immediate deployment of cloud-based AI providers in February 2025, followed by LlamA, Gemini, and Claude in March-April 2025, with additional platforms in June-July 2025. The integration will be managed through the Realbotix app, with pricing details to be announced closer to release.
Realbotix Corp (XBOTF) reported its FY-2024 financial results, showing significant revenue growth of 378% to $1.3 million compared to $268k in FY-2023. The company holds $9.7 million in digital assets and cash, with total assets increasing by 24% year-over-year.
Despite reporting a net loss of $8.7 million, primarily due to non-cash impairments of $9.3 million, the operating loss from continuing operations improved to $442k from $1.3 million in the previous year. Key developments include the acquisition of Simulacra , launch of a Normal Course Issuer Bid program, and partnership with Compass UOL including a $100,000 AWS subsidy.
The company unveiled its latest humanoid robot, Melody, at CES 2025, generating over 4 billion global media impressions. Realbotix continues to stake approximately 60% of its ETH holdings and sold 250 ETH in December 2024 and January 2025 for working capital.
